    Story

    In 2016 I suffered 3 strokes followed by a forth stroke at some point between the scans in Dec.2016 and August 2017.

    These strokes had a major impact on my life and more can be read in my story here that I shared via different strokes charity https://differentstrokes.co.uk/stories/jo-c-cross/

    Since then I use my rehab to try and raise awareness and funds for people that helped me from rehab hospital.to charities that supported me.

    CHANCES was something I set up.i love my music and festivals and it was something I missed greatly so we decided to do a mini festival.theme fundraiser locally in 2018 and 2019 and both went well. We now want to continue and go bigger next year but need to fundraise to cover the costs so we can make as much money as possible for these causes.

    You can follow chances festival online Facebook and Instagram to view the pilot and 2019 CHANCES photos and how it went.

    We hope to see you in 2020
